Transaction 07d3870cc9ba4ebfa5a55fe757564d099dfc81f70872ebf9beedcc4db310e116

1 Input
2 Outputs
  • 07d3870cc9ba4ebfa5a55fe757564d099dfc81f70872ebf9beedcc4db310e116:0
  • value  591816
    address  151RD5c1HExwbev5WcjnfAtuuMFvzZysWS
  • 07d3870cc9ba4ebfa5a55fe757564d099dfc81f70872ebf9beedcc4db310e116:1
  • value  1763218
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s